ios-字串過濾和替換
備註:1.注意**中的特殊的空格!!!
#pragma mark 檢測並過來手機號碼字串(以逗號分隔的)中的無效字元.+(nsstring*) validandfiltermobilephonenumber : (nsstring*) mobilephonenumber(#%-*+=_)\\|~(<>$%^&*)_+ "];//注意最後2個空格是不一樣的,16進製制分別是20、c2a0
nsarray* arr = [mobilephonenumber componentsseparatedbycharactersinset:donotwant];
nsstring* result = [arr componentsjoinedbystring:@""];
return result;
}
iOS 字串替換
有這樣的需求 字串中有幾處特殊字元,我們需要替換 此時可以考慮使用nsstring 的方法 stringbyreplacingoccurrencesofstring 我們看乙個簡單例子 objc view plain copy nsstring string 2011 11 29 string st...
iOS過濾非法字串
碰到在搜尋框中過濾非法字元的問題,傳統的用while迴圈來操作就顯得太繁瑣,ios 的 nsstring 裡有相關的方法可以解決此問題。如下 nscharacterset donotwant nscharacterset charactersetwithcharactersinstring temp...
字串擷取和字串替換
substring 叫做擷取字串,split叫做字串分割 substring擷取,下面是從第0位擷取前3個 說白了是從第一位擷取前3個 中的0索引就是我們常說的第一位 列印結果 用一生 split擷取,下面是通過 擷取,把字元分為6部分 string txta 用,一,生,下,載,你 string ...